Some people like to add a little water, stir, and add the rest. It really doesn't matter. The … Web2 jun. 2024 · Tip 3: Use coarse coffee grounds. The metal filter in the French press prevents the coffee grounds from escaping into your brew when you pour it out into your mug. Finer grinds (anything finer than medium-coarse) and “fines” (the dust-sized particles from the grinding process) will make it through the filter. Web27 feb. 2024 · Step 7: Push Down the Grounds. After steeping you need to get rid of those grounds so you can enjoy your brew. Push down on the plunger gently towards the bottom of the press. If you see too many particles left over in your brew, it means the grounds are too fine so you need to adjust the grind next time. Web14 nov. 2024 · To start, measure out 14 grams of coffee for every eight ounces of water you plan to use. You can also measure the coffee ground by scoops if you don’t have a scale (14g = 1. scoop = 3 tbsp). If you want to make stronger coffee, add some extra grounds. Then, place the coffee in your French Press.
